Your new role
As a Senior Quantity Surveyor, you will collaborate closely with your line manager to oversee themercial administration, reporting, and performance of either a single large project or multiple smaller schemes, in this case a major highway project.
Key Accountabilities:
Ensure a safe working environment.
Prepare subcontract documentation, including the negotiation of terms and conditions, prices, and programme.
Manage subcontract works packages, including interim assessments of amounts due and subsequent change management.
Issue all requiredmercial notices to both the Client and Subcontractors in accordance with the contract.
Oversee and manage changes promptly in accordance with the contract, including the preparation and submission ofpensation Event Quotations.
Prepare, submit, and agree on monthly applications to the client in accordance with the contract.
Liaise with operational and engineering staff to ensure site records meet the required standards.
Prepare detailed monthly reports and Cost Value Reconciliations (CVR) as required by the business unit or project.
Maintain a detailed ‘Cost Plan,’ tracking and forecasting expenditure, including detailed schedules of Subcontractor ‘liabilities’ and utilising Oracle-based cost analyses
